Board Resolution 2020-08-08(b)

Meeting room

Topic: Creditable Service
Subtopic: Termination of Irregular Service Policy
Date: 7/30/2020
Status: Active

WHEREAS, Section 7-198 of the Illinois Pension Code authorizes the Board of Trustees of the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und (IMRF) to establish rules necessary or desirable for the efficient administration of the Fund; and

WHEREAS, Section 7-200 of the Illinois Pension Code authorizes the Board of Trustees to make decisions on participation and coverage; and

WHEREAS, the Board of Trustees has historically permitted individuals who work in a qualified position twelve months each year, but receive their pay irregularly or sporadically, to receive twelve months of service credit despite not receiving pay in each calendar month; and

WHEREAS, this type of service, termed “irregular service”, was established by the Board of Trustees, but has no further basis in the Illinois Pension Code and is, in fact, in direct conflict with the Illinois Pension Code; and

WHEREAS, IMRF should award service credit only as expressly provided under the Illinois Pension Code.

TH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ED that the following administrative rules be and are hereby adopted by the Board of Trustees:

  1. As of the effective date of this resolution, individuals hired into a position which receives irregular pay will only receive service credit in the months in which the individual receives pay which is consistent with the cash basis rule set forth in the Pension Code.
  2. Any individuals who have been credited with irregular service as of the effective date of this resolution will continue to receive irregular service credit through December 31, 2020, as long as that individual continues to serve in that particular position or office at their IMRF participating employer.
  3. This resolution does not impact seasonal employees as defined in 40 ILCS 5/7-109.1.
  4. As of January 1, 2021, no member may earn irregular service credit.

This resolution will become effective as of its date of adoption.
